Shelly Design and Manufacturing Company

 Sub-Series — Box: 6
Identifier: Sub-Series 8
Scope and Contents Shelly Design and Manufacturing Company subseries contains organizational charts and the mission statement of the company, which was founded by Shelly, Harry Carlson, Don Frisbie, Larry Frisbie, H.J. "Sco" Scofield, and Brian Knutson. The company was intended to be an avenue by which the founders could secure manufacturing of their designs and products through outside vendors. The company's founders desired to be leaders in manufacturing and design of "specialized machinery." It appears that...

Scope and Contents From the Series: This series contains information pertaining to Shelly’s personal life. The North Dakota State University file documents Shelly’s attendance at NDSU from 1937 through 1943, the Alumni Achievement Award he received from NDSU in 1962, and the honorary Doctor of Science degree NDSU granted him in 1970. The University of North Dakota file contains the Commencement Bulletin from 1993, when Shelly received an honorary Doctor of Engineering degree. Two certificates show Shelly’s membership in the...

"Balloon Design Estimator", 1962

 File — Box: 6, Folder: 19
Identifier: Folder 19
Scope and Contents From the Sub-Series:

The Products subseries contains files regarding products that have been designed or made by Shelly or Sheldahl, including polyethylene bags; samples of Novaflex adhesives; the Polaris Rupture Disc, used in the Polaris Mark XVII fleet ballistic missile; and, Schjelamel-10 laminate, developed for manned flights of spacecraft and for carrying very heavy loads, as well as a laminate book containing samples of all of Company's laminates.
